The campus remained in use as Palos Verdes Intermediate School, with the former intermediate schools having been closed as part of the reorganization. In 2002, climbing enrollments and overcrowding at Peninsula High School led the district to reopen Palos Verdes High School. By the first year, enrollment reached 470 students. [5]

John Welbourn (born March 30, 1976) is a former American football offensive tackle and guard. He was drafted by the Philadelphia Eagles in the fourth round of the 1999 NFL draft. He played college football for the California Golden Bears at the University of California, Berkeley. Welbourn has also been a member of the Kansas City Chiefs and New ...

Palos Verdes Peninsula High School is a public high school in Rolling Hills Estates, Los Angeles County, California, United States, in the Los Angeles metropolitan area. As of 2023, it is a top-ranked school in the Los Angeles, CA Metro Area (#16) and California (#42), according to US News & World Report.

Scott played for Palos Verdes High School. [2] He became the starting quarterback early in the 2012 season. [2] During the 2012 season, he passed for a total of 1988 yards. [3] In 2012, with Scott in the starting position, Palos Verdes won the Bay League title [4] [5] and the CIF Southern Section title for the first time in 47 years. [6]
